Output 81668b0db59bea9145e267710aacece227019372cffc9c4dd36cb2806a02f9cc:1

value
583635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ef8dd50bc99a55acb6847b6b54a0fe65d66f5246 OP_EQUAL
address
3PXfL4nLEGUD4YQNTPEL8ovuFPf9Y794q7
transaction
81668b0db59bea9145e267710aacece227019372cffc9c4dd36cb2806a02f9cc
spent
true